As everyone is aware, especially those outside the UK, watching TV programmes on the BBC's iPlayer is a no, no for anyone outside the UK (and can even be a problem at times if your are in the UK).
There are ways round with proxy servers and is often discussed here but it's not always easy. Click, the BBC technology programme which goes out on both BBC News and BBC World News this week has an item on what can and can't and getting round the restrictions using VPN's and proxy's. Not quite a step-by-step guide, they'd be breaking the law doing that, but useful tips.
